About this course
- You’ll study the many facets of Philosophy in depth including metaphysics, epistemology and moral philosophyFrom the beginning you’ll be encouraged and taught how to think rigorously, defend your views, understand different opinions and ultimately develop a sharp, analytical and open mind Our wide range of optional modules give you the opportunity to customise your degree according to your own interests and career ambitions The Philosophy student society will give you the chance to make friends, attend socials and seminars and hear from guest speakers Get ready for your future career by developing a range of skills valued by a wide range of employers from the media to teaching and the public, private and charity sectors
